Description
Crunchy, scorched rock on the lower half of this shorty mars this little thin hands splitter. Still, it climbs alright and adds to the Capulin 5.10s list.
A few paces left of Tips Up. A finger crack leads to a small block that looks like it should come out but feels surprisingly solid. Above the block it's thin hands to hands to a hidden anchor just over the lip to the right.
If you're curious about the name, take a look up above from the anchor.
